Output 17c9953fbb623adfb2bfc8b04a4d716b8d96af7f02da247e2c51b25a97d6e5be:0

value
6405
script pubkey
OP_0 OP_PUSHBYTES_20 d2d8cb96bd4c4f47cd12d529ee6300ac427f2ddd
address
bc1q6tvvh94af3850ngj6557uccq43p87twanvgt78
transaction
17c9953fbb623adfb2bfc8b04a4d716b8d96af7f02da247e2c51b25a97d6e5be
confirmations
82916
spent
true